Why Choose Mallorca for Your Wedding?
Mallorca (Majorca), the largest of Spain’s Balearic Islands, combines breathtaking landscapes with world-class hospitality. Couples from the UK, Europe, and the US choose Mallorca for its:
- 300+ days of sunshine per year
- Stunning sea views and mountain backdrops
- Luxury private fincas and villas
- Easy international flight connections
- Exceptional food and wine
- Experienced English-speaking wedding suppliers
Whether you’re planning an intimate elopement or a 150-guest villa celebration, Mallorca offers unmatched versatility.
Best Places to Get Married in Mallorca
Choosing the right venue is key when planning a wedding in Mallorca. Here are some of the most popular venue styles:
1. Luxury Finca Weddings
Traditional Mallorcan fincas are rustic estates surrounded by olive groves, citrus trees, and mountains. Perfect for elegant outdoor celebrations.
Popular areas:
- Soller
- Valldemosa
- Pollensa
- Deia
2. Seafront & Beach Weddings
Imagine exchanging vows overlooking turquoise waters. Coastal venues in:
- Port Andratx
- Deià
- Cala d’Or
- Palma Bay
offer breathtaking Mediterranean views.
3. Historic Villas & Boutique Hotels
For couples wanting glamour and convenience, Mallorca has stunning 5-star hotels and heritage villas in Palma’s Old Town and beyond.
Legal Requirements for Getting Married in Mallorca
Many international couples choose to have a symbolic ceremony in Mallorca due to Spanish legal requirements.
Civil Weddings in Mallorca
Legal civil weddings can be complex for non-residents, often requiring:
- Residency paperwork
- Official translations
- Extended time in Spain
Symbolic or Celebrant Weddings
The most popular option for destination weddings in Mallorca. Couples legally marry at home and have a personalised ceremony on the island.
Catholic church weddings are possible but involve strict documentation and religious requirements.

How Much Does a Wedding in Mallorca Cost?
Wedding costs vary depending on guest count, venue, and style.
Estimated 2026 budget ranges:
- Venue hire: €3,000 – €12,000
- Catering: €150 – €250 per guest
- Planner: €3,000 – €6,000
- Photographer: €2,500 – €5,000
- Flowers & décor: €3,000 – €10,000
- Entertainment: €1,500 – €5,000
Average total budget: €25,000 – €60,000+
Luxury weddings can exceed €100,000 depending on scale.
Best Time of Year to Get Married in Mallorca
The wedding season runs from April to October.
Spring (April–June)
- Mild temperatures
- Blooming landscapes
- Ideal for outdoor ceremonies
Summer (July–August)
- Hot and sunny
- Perfect for late-evening celebrations
- Peak pricing
Autumn (September–October)
- Warm sea temperatures
- Softer light for photography
- Slightly lower venue demand
May, June, and September are considered the best months for weddings in Mallorca.
Top Tips for Planning a Destination Wedding in Mallorca
1. Hire a Local Wedding Planner
A Mallorca-based planner will have trusted supplier connections and understand venue regulations.
2. Visit the Island Before Booking
If possible, schedule a planning trip to view venues and meet suppliers.
3. Consider Guest Travel & Accommodation
Palma Airport is well connected, but provide guests with hotel options and transport details early.
4. Plan for Heat
Summer weddings require shade, hydration stations, and later ceremony times.
5. Book Early
Popular venues book 12–24 months in advance.
